Dev starrer Raghu Dakat gets its poster unveiled, teaser to be out tomorrow

| @indiablooms | Aug 14, 2025, at 04:28 pm

Kolkata/IBNS: The poster of Bengali film superstar Dev starrer Raghu Dakat was unveiled by the makers on Thursday.

The film is directed by Dhrubo Banerjee.

The poster features Dev, in a never-before-seen avatar, taking on the mantle of Raghu Dakat, the outlaw whose name once thundered across Bengal, blurring the lines between fear and reverence.

In this look, Raghu charges forward on horseback, eyes blazing, weapon raised, a man driven by vengeance, bound by destiny, and destined to become myth.

Also written by Dhrubo Banerjee, Raghu Dakat narrates the mythical tale of a savior who emerged during the 18th century, a period of great turmoil and unrest.

Dev, whose last film Khadaan was a massive success, had earlier collaborated with Dhrubo Banerjee for Golondaaj.

The teaser of the film will be released digitally on Friday.

Presented by SVF Entertainment and Dev Entertainment Ventures, Raghu Dakat gallops into theatres this Puja 2025.
